Output ece2414bfc9411aa69e4e6a2807c92a08c5395a0ddef8f8dffedea4a9947a67f:3

value
3542418
script pubkey
OP_0 OP_PUSHBYTES_20 f62e377b712661e5f8f3fa7cb923d8482785aedf
address
bc1q7chrw7m3yes7t78nlf7tjg7cfqncttkleq25p9
transaction
ece2414bfc9411aa69e4e6a2807c92a08c5395a0ddef8f8dffedea4a9947a67f
confirmations
2132
spent
false